Don't miss the April 30th Chapter meeting in Lafayette!

Please join Virginia Benoist, Esq. Assistant Attorney General, of the LA Attorney General’s Office/LA Department of Insurance, as she leads this month’s Chapter meeting, “Response to an Emergency or Disaster in the State of Louisiana.” Come join us for an informative presentation that will explain how one agency developed their continuity of operations plans and how they are preparing for other emergency or disaster situations that may occur in Louisiana. Whether you work for a public agency or a private company, this presentation can help you learn more about how to ensure your organization’s operations can and will continue after a disaster. The meeting will be held at the Lafayette Parish Library Conference Room, 301 W. Congress Street, in Lafayette. Lunch will be served at 11:30, followed by Chapter announcements and Benoist’s presentation.
